Question
solve this system of equations by graphing. first graph the equations, and then type the solution.
y = 3x - 1
y = -3x - 7
click to select points on the graph.
Step1: Find intercepts for $y=3x-1$
For x-intercept: set $y=0$,
$0=3x-1 \implies 3x=1 \implies x=\frac{1}{3}$
Point: $(\frac{1}{3}, 0)$
For y-intercept: set $x=0$,
$y=3(0)-1=-1$
Point: $(0, -1)$
Step2: Find intercepts for $y=-3x-7$
For x-intercept: set $y=0$,
$0=-3x-7 \implies 3x=-7 \implies x=-\frac{7}{3}$
Point: $(-\frac{7}{3}, 0)$
For y-intercept: set $x=0$,
$y=-3(0)-7=-7$
Point: $(0, -7)$
Step3: Find intersection algebraically
Set $3x-1=-3x-7$
$3x+3x=-7+1$
$6x=-6 \implies x=-1$
Substitute $x=-1$ into $y=3x-1$:
$y=3(-1)-1=-4$

The solution to the system is $(-1, -4)$
(Graph points: For $y=3x-1$, plot $(\frac{1}{3}, 0)$ and $(0, -1)$ and draw the line; for $y=-3x-7$, plot $(-\frac{7}{3}, 0)$ and $(0, -7)$ and draw the line, they intersect at $(-1, -4)$)
